NAME

       cyclades-devices - tables for driving cyclades-serial-client

DESCRIPTION

       The  cyclades-devices  file  supplies all mapping between Unix device files (/dev/*) and the addresses of
       serial ports of Cyclades Terminal Servers. It contains one entry for each serial port, with the following
       format:

       device:rastype:rasname:physport:type:options

       Note: A # character at beginning of line indicates a comment

       The entry fields are:

       devname
              - A full pathname of the file that will be associated to the serial port. It must  start  with   a
              "/dev/"  preffix.   Two  naming  schemes  may  be used here: - devname does not exist, and will be
              linked to a free pseudo-tty. This is the default behavior of cyclades-ser-cli.  - devname  is  the
              name  of  a  valid  slave pseudo-tty.  In this case, the ´-t 1´ option must be assigned in options
              field.  (Note: this option is not supported by this release).

       rastype
              - Terminal Server type: - prts, for Cyclades Pr302X/TS Terminal Servers.   -  path,  for  Cyclades
              PathRAS Terminal Server.

       rasname
              - Host Name or IP Address of the Terminal Server where the serial port resides.

       physport
              -  Number  of  physical port in the Terminal Server. If ´physport´ is  assigned to zero, ´rasname´
              will be treated as the IP address associated with this port, in a IP-based addressing scheme.

       type   - Server type that will be contacted to handle the serial  port:  -  rtelnet,  for  Remote  Telnet
              Server - socket, for Socket Server

       options
              - Per-port specific options, passed to cyclades-ser-cli program.

EXAMPLES

       1.  Device  on  a  PR3020/TS  Terminal Server pr3k Port 1, accessed through /dev/ctty01 device file name,
       using telnet protocol (remote telnet server)

       /dev/ctty01:prts:pr3k:1:rtelnet:

       2. The same device, but with an IP address pr3k_port1  associated  to  the  serial  port  (IP-based  port
       addressing)

       /dev/ctty01:prts:pr3k_port1:0:rtelnet:

       3.  Device on a PathRAS Terminal Server pr3k Port 2, accessed through /dev/ctty02 device file name, using
       socket protocol (socket server)

       /dev/ctty02:path:pr3k:2:socket:
